  • In this video, we talk a look at how you can use the Radio Reference Database on RadioReference.com to see what services and frequencies can be listened to or monitored. It is also helpful for determining what type of scanner or radio you will need.

    Hi, a PSAP is a Public Safety Answering Point, and used for emergency and non-emergency calls. I was in a profession for a long time in which we fielded calls from all over the country. When we received 911 calls they were automatically connected to a PSAP who then connected to the police/fire/EMS for the particular city/county/state.
